It doesn't look like it. The first movie didn't do as well as anticipated and was actually really poorly received (I believe Rotten Tomatoes gave it only somewhere around a 16%). Originally, they expected it to be much bigger, and set the film up for Eldest, however it was determined at the time that it wasn't worth the second film. Though it's possible, a second movie is very unlikely and is not currently in the works.
